We have partnered with Visit Essex to give targeted support to businesses in the visitor economy. We know that the visitor economy has been particularly hard hit over recent times. So, we are keen to work with Visit Essex and businesses to provide support in this area.
With the free Visit Essex membership, you will be able to have your own entry on www.visitessex.com with online booking facilities. Visit Essex will also include your business in relevant marketing activities and campaigns.
In addition, you can enjoy:
- access to free training courses
- invitations to Visit Essex events
- monthly member newsletters and industry updates
- access to Visit Essex’s image library for you to use freely on your website to promote what Essex has to offer

We are working with MKR Solutions to support businesses to develop and carry out a decarbonisation plan. This will help businesses reduce their carbon footprint, increase productivity and make financial savings.
This programme gives 1-2-1 support and can help businesses from across all sectors. It focuses on the collective culture of continuous improvement to maintain and drive change in line with Net Zero goals.
To gain the most value from this programme, your businesses should be at least 18 months old.

Finance, loans and debt management
The Recovery Loan Scheme helps small and medium sized businesses access loans and finance to aid their recovery.
The British Business Bank has free resources around debt management, cash flow, and understanding and managing debt. If you are struggling to pay your self-assessment tax bill, HMRC is offering instalments and payment plans.
Business Debtline is a charity that provides free and independent debt advice over the phone and online. It also provides a range of debt advice factsheets on topics ranging from business debts, debt solutions to dealing with creditors.

The Essex Wellbeing Service supports Essex businesses via their Working Well Accreditation.
This consists of:
- workplace health and wellbeing sessions
- Mental Health First Aid training
- the Working Well Accreditation, where organisations can be recognised for their commitment to staff health and wellbeing
